Collections

Tsuramitsu
Dragon on Boar's Tuskearly to mid-19th century

Not on view
Carved ivory-colored tusk-shaped vessel with a detailed dragon in relief coiling across the curved surface, with East Asian script inscription
Carved ivory tusk section in a curved, crescent form with an open rectangular end, decorated with a relief-carved dragon coiling along the surface, with a small inscription in East Asian script near the center.
Artist or Maker
Tsuramitsu
Japan, Iwami, 1793-1859
Title
Dragon on Boar's Tusk
Place Made
Japan
Date Made
early to mid-19th century
Period
Edo period (1603 - 1868)
Medium
Boar tusk
Dimensions
3 13/16 x 3/4 x 7/16 in. (9.8 x 1.9 x 1.1 cm)
Credit Line
Raymond and Frances Bushell Collection
Accession Number
AC1998.249.218
Classification
Costumes
Collecting Area
Japanese Art
